What to Check Before Registration

A credible casino should make essential information easy to locate. Players should be able to find licensing details, responsible gambling tools, accepted payment methods, withdrawal conditions, and support channels without searching through several unrelated pages. Clear presentation is often a useful first indication of how seriously an operator treats transparency.

Account creation should also be straightforward. New customers may need to verify their identity before withdrawing funds, so it is sensible to understand the documentation process in advance. A smooth verification system can prevent unnecessary delays later, particularly when larger transactions are involved.

  • Confirm that the operator displays relevant regulatory information.
  • Read the bonus terms before opting into an offer.
  • Check deposit and withdrawal limits for the preferred payment method.
  • Review available self-exclusion, deposit-limit, and reality-check tools.
  • Test whether customer support responds clearly and promptly.

Games, Software, and Mobile Experience

A broad lobby can serve several types of player. Slots may appeal to users who prefer quick sessions and changing themes, while roulette, blackjack, and baccarat provide a more traditional table-game experience. Live casino titles add streamed dealers and real-time interaction, although they may require a stronger internet connection and often have higher minimum stakes.

Software quality matters as much as the number of titles. Games should load consistently, display correctly on smaller screens, and provide accessible information about paylines, rules, features, and maximum wins. A mobile-first layout is particularly valuable for players using tablets or smartphones, since menus and cashier pages should remain usable without excessive zooming or scrolling.

Bonuses: Value Depends on the Conditions

A welcome offer can look attractive while providing limited practical value if the requirements are difficult to complete. The headline amount is only one part of the calculation. Players should examine the wagering requirement, eligible games, contribution rates, minimum deposit, maximum bet, expiry period, and any restrictions on withdrawals.

For example, a slot may contribute fully toward wagering, while a table game may contribute only partially or be excluded entirely. A bonus with a lower advertised value may therefore be more useful if its terms are simpler and its expiry period is longer. Free spins can also carry separate rules, including a maximum win or a requirement to use winnings within a specific timeframe.

Deposits, Withdrawals, and Verification

Payment convenience has a direct effect on the overall casino experience. Common methods may include bank cards, online wallets, bank transfers, and other electronic options, but availability can vary by account, location, and verification status. Before depositing, players should check transaction limits and whether the operator charges any fees.

Withdrawals deserve particular attention. A fast deposit does not necessarily mean a fast payout, because withdrawals may involve internal review, identity checks, or processing by a third-party payment provider. It is wise to use a payment method registered in the account holder’s name and to keep requested documents clear, current, and complete.

Responsible Gambling and Final Assessment

Responsible gambling features should be treated as core account functions, not optional extras. A reliable platform should support deposit limits, time reminders, cooling-off periods, and self-exclusion. Players can also protect their budget by setting a fixed entertainment amount, avoiding borrowed money, and stopping when a session reaches its planned limit.
